Steven Bernstein & Sexmob @ 30


Steven Bernstein - Slide Trumpet

Briggan Krauss - Alto/Baritone Sax

Tony Scherr - Bass

Kenny Wollesen - Drums


Still thriving and evolving 30 years since its founding, the visionary quartet Sexmob continues to explode all preconceived notions of what an instrumental jazz band can be. Formed in 1996 out of a weekly residency at New York’s Knitting Factory, the band — slide trumpeter Steven Bernstein, alto/baritone saxophonist Briggan Krauss, bassist Tony Scherr, and drummer Kenny Wollesen — have changed the game with its raw, improvisatory groove and swing, endlessly inventive arrangements, and uproarious sense of fun, exhibiting high musical standards while blithely blowing past all boundaries of genre and taste.
